Budget Deal Doesnt Cut Spending
Posted by Chris Edwards
Republicans and Democrats have come together on a historic budget deal that cuts federal spending by more than $2 trillion over 10 years. The Washington Posts lead story calls the cuts sharp and severe.
However, the budget deal doesnt cut federal spending at all.

Let Us Look Back at the Calm, Rational Rhetoric of the Debt Ceiling Circus
Now that the debt ceiling circus is all over but the voting and back-slapping, why not look back at some of the well-considered and not-at-abatspit-crazy statements made by certain influential members of the left over the past few days. We can start very near the top, with this nugget of reason from Vice President Joe Biden.
Vice President Joe Biden joined House Democrats in lashing tea party Republicans Monday, accusing them of having acted like terrorists in the fight over raising the nations debt limit.
Biden was agreeing with a line of argument made by Rep. Mike Doyle (D-Pa.) at a two-hour, closed-door Democratic Caucus meeting.
We have negotiated with terrorists, an angry Doyle said, according to sources in the room. This small group of terrorists have made it impossible to spend any money.
Biden, driven by his Democratic allies misgivings about the debt-limit deal, responded: They have acted like terrorists, according to several sources in the room.
Hmm. That wasnt quite what I expected from a leader of the Democrats who, youll recall, lectured Tea Party members for their violent rhetoric not all that long ago. Perhaps White House adviser and CNN contributor Fareed Zakaria exercised a bit more calm.
the Tea Party is trying to pass a particular agenda, which is basically this all-cuts budget. It cannot get it through the Congress of the United States. It cannot get it through the political democratic process that we have, which is that Congress passes something and the president must sign it. Thats the normal workings of democracy.
So, instead of accepting some compromise that can get through the democratic process, what theyre saying is well blow up the country if you dont listen to us. Well hold hostage the credit of the United States, the good standing of the United States and well blow it up.
Blow up America? Hold it hostage? Well, thats pretty much the Biden line. Gee, Im beginning to detect a carefully-scripted talking point. Hopefully the hypocrisy ended there. Id hate to see it spread into, say, Congress.
Rep. Emanuel Clever (D-Mo.) called the newly agreed-upon bipartisan compromise deal to raise the debt limit a sugar-coated satan sandwich.
This deal is a sugar-coated satan sandwich. If you lift the bun, you will not like what you see, Clever tweeted Monday.
Good news: no more terrorist analogies. Bad news: Satan? Really? The Prince of Lies himself? I dont see how the rhetoric could get any more ridiculous!
In an interview with ABC News Diane Sawyer, [Former Speaker of the House Nancy] Pelosi said she will absolutely vote yes on the compromise package, even though she agreed with one colleague who called it a Satan sandwich.
It probably is with some Satan fries on the side, Pelosi said.
Oof! A Satan sandwich with Satan fries? Did she forget the Satan Diet Coke and the little packets of Satan ketchup that would have completely the Infernal Unhappy Meal?
